Massachusetts inspection stickers will not be issued for third consecutive day after malware attack on vendor, according to RMV



[ad_1]

A supplier to the Massachusetts Motor Vehicle Registry is still working to fully restore vehicle inspections after a malware attack disrupted service on Tuesday.

Massachusetts inspection stickers will not be issued for the third consecutive day. The problem ended inspections on Tuesday and motorists have not been able to obtain stickers since.

In a statement Wednesday night, Wisconsin-based Applus Technologies, Inc. said it detected and stopped a malware attack that was temporarily preventing Massachusetts and other states from conducting vehicle inspections.

Applus Technologies said it “will take some time to fully restore the functionality of vehicle inspections,” in part because the company needs to reset its IT environment.

“Unfortunately, such incidents are quite common and no one is immune,” said Darrin Greene, CEO of Applus Technologies, Inc. in a statement. “We apologize for any inconvenience this incident may cause. We know our customers and many vehicle owners trust our technology and we are committed to getting back to normal operations as quickly as possible. “

While Applus Technologies fixes the issue, many of the March 2020 inspection stickers have expired. The RMV has notified law enforcement and asks for its cooperation and discretion not to name drivers who have visited an inspection site on Tuesday or Wednesday.

RMV on Wednesday urged Applus Technologies to provide a timeline and confirm the extent of the outage, which the agency said has affected drivers and small businesses operating inspection stations across the country.

“Recognizing the inconvenience caused by the Applus outage, RMV has been in contact with law enforcement to request cooperation and discretion citing those with an expired sticker who allegedly attempted to visit a station this week,” said RMV.

RMV also extended the 60-day retesting requirement during the outage. RMV noted that the interruption would not affect planned or future training, nor the processing of new inspectors or renewed station licenses.
